HYMN LI.

Eighth Sunday after Trinity.

Luke xii. 29-37. 40.

Seek not what ye shall eat, nor what ye shall drink: neither be ye of doubtful mind; For all these things do the nations of the world seek after and your Father knoweth that ye have need of these things.

:

But rather seek ye the kingdom of God: and all these things shall be added unto you. Fear not, little flock: for it is your Father's good pleasure to give you the kingdom.

Sell that ye have, and give alms : provide yourselves bags which wax not old,

A treasure in the heavens that faileth not: where no thief approacheth, neither moth corrupteth.

For where your treasure is there will your heart be also.

Let your loins be girded about : and your lights burning;

And ye yourselves like unto men that wait for their Lord: when he will return from the wedding;

That when he cometh and knocketh: they may open unto him immediately.

Blessed are those servants: whom the Lord when he cometh shall find watching.

Be ye therefore ready also for the Son of Man cometh at an hour when ye think

not.

HYMN LII.

Ninth Sunday after Trinity.

Isaiah xii. 1–6.

O LORD, I will praise thee: though thou wast angry with me,

Thine anger is turned away and thou comfortedst me.

Behold, God is my salvation: I will trust, and not be afraid;

For the LORD JEHOVAH is my strength and my song: he also is become my salvation.

Therefore with joy shall ye draw water : out of the wells of salvation.

And in that day shall ye say: Praise the LORD, call upon his name;

Declare his doings among the people : make mention that his name is exalted.

Sing unto the LORD, for he hath done excellent things: this is known in all the earth.

Cry out and shout thou inhabitant of Zion;

For great is the Holy One of Israel : in the midst of thee.

HYMN LIII.

Tenth Sunday after Trinity.

Ephesians vi. 10-18.

Finally, my brethren, be strong in the LORD and in the power of his might;

Put on the whole armour of God: that ye may be able to stand against the wiles of the devil.

For we wrestle not against flesh and blood: but against principalities, against powers; Against the rulers of the darkness of this world against spiritual wickedness in high places.

:

Wherefore take to you the whole armour of God: that ye may be able to withstand in the evil day, and having done all, to stand.

Stand therefore, having your loins girt about with truth: and having on the breastplate of righteousness;

And your feet shod with the preparation of the gospel of peace;

Above all, taking the shield of faith: wherewith ye shall be able to quench the fiery darts of the wicked.

And take the helmet of salvation: and the sword of the Spirit, which is the word of God;

Praying always with all prayer: and supplication in the Spirit.

HYMN LIV.

Eleventh Sunday after Trinity.

Job v. 8-13. 15, 16.

I would seek unto God and unto God

would I commit my cause;

Which doeth great things and unsearchable marvellous things without number;

:

Who giveth rain upon the earth and sendeth waters upon the fields

;

To set upon high those that be low : that those which mourn may be exalted to safety. He disappointeth the devices of the crafty: so that their hands cannot perform their enterprise :

He taketh the wise in their own craftiness : and the counsel of the froward is carried headlong.

But he saveth the poor from the sword: from their mouth, and from the hand of the mighty.

:

So the poor hath hope and iniquity stoppeth her mouth.
